Manchester United fans, no need to worry. We are not talking about David De Gea here. Not even the second choice Sergio Romero. Yeah this is about the “long time no see” Victor Valdes.
The Mirror has revealed that Victor Valdes is following Middlesbrough on twitter. Its not a big deal you may think but if you look at Valdes’ account you will see that the 34 year old goalkeeper only followed three clubs so far. Standard Liege, Barcelona and Manchester United. What is the common denominator for these three clubs? Well he has played in all three.
Thus don’t blame us for bringing you this news as it is almost likely that Valdes will leave Manchester United this summer and we will not blame him if he joins Middlesbrough. The Spaniard won every possible trophy in his career but has made only two appearances for the United team. Given his age, he still has another 4-5 years left in his career and he should look to spend it somewhere he is needed.
It has been confirmed a few hours earlier that the former Man United and Barcelona shot-stopper has in fact moved to Middlesbrough.
“You can’t imagine how delighted I am because it’s not usual to bring players like him to recently promoted teams,” said head coach Aitor Karanka.
Karanka told the club’s official website: “He knows how strong this group is. It’s a privilege for us to be able to bring a player like this to the club.”
Valdes has more than 100 champions league games under his belt and will bring immense experience to the newly promoted Middlesbrough, who have completed their 5th signing of the summer with the purchase of Valdes.
